Overview

Proposed framework improves motion retargeting for humanoid robots, suggesting enhanced scalability and efficiency.

Key Points

  • IKMR framework achieves efficient motion retargeting, enabling real-time scalability for humanoid robots across varied tasks.
  • The framework integrates motion topology representation and a dual encoder-decoder architecture for effective learning.
  • Extensive experiments validate the effectiveness of the proposed approach on humanoid robots in simulation and real-world settings.
  • The dynamics integration in IKMR allows for refining motion into physically feasible trajectories, enhancing controller training.
